New JEE Mains Syllabus 2024 

While the recent changes to the JEE Mains syllabus 2024 may come as a surprise to some, many had already anticipated this shift. This is due to the revisions made to the NCERT books for classes 11 and 12 in 2020-2021. The current syllabus changes are merely an extension of those earlier revisions, specifically targeting the 2024 batch of JEE Mains aspirants.

JEE Maths Syllabus 2024

If there is any subject that has had the maximum changes, it’s Mathematics. From a total unit reduction to sub-topics reduction, almost every unit has been altered. Let us do a complete analysis of the syllabus. 

Unit 1: Sets, Relations and Functions
  • No changes have been made in this unit. 
Unit 2: Complex Numbers and Quadratic Equations
  • The square root of a complex number and triangle inequality have been removed.
Unit 3: Matrices and Determinants
  • Properties of Determinants have been removed.
  • Elementary Transformations has been removed.
  • Tests of consistency and solution of simultaneous linear equations in two or three variables using determinants have been removed.
Unit 4: Permutations and Combinations
  • There has been no change in the syllabus of this.
Unit 5: Mathematical Induction
  • The entire chapter has been removed from the syllabus.
Unit 6: Binomial Theorem and its Simple Applications
  • Properties of Binomial coefficients are removed.
Unit 7: Sequence and Series
  • Sum up  n-terms of special series; Sn, Sn2, Sn3 has been removed.
  • Arithmetico – Geometric progression has been removed.
Unit 8: Lmit, Continuity and Differentiability
  • Rolle’s and Lagrange’s mean value theorems have been removed from the syllabus.
  • Tangents and normal from the chapter of Maxima and Minima of functions of one variable have been removed.
Unit 9: Integral Calculus
  • Integral as the limit of a sum has been removed.
Unit 10: Differential Equations
  • The formation of differential equations has been removed.
Unit 11: Coordinate Geometry
  • Translation of axes has been removed.

Straight Lines

  • Equations of internal and external bisectors of angles between two lines have been removed from the syllabus.
  • Equations of the family of lines passing through the point of intersection of two lines have been removed from the syllabus.

Circle, Conic Sections

  • Condition for a line to be tangent to a circle has been removed.
  • Equation of the tangent has been removed.
  • Condition for y = mx+c to be a tangent and point (s) of tangency has been removed.
Unit 12: Three-Dimensional Geometry
  • A plane in different forms has been removed.
  • The intersection of a line and a plane has been removed.
  • Coplanar Lines have been removed.
Unit 13: Vector Algebra
  • The Scalar and Vector triple product also called the STP and VTP, which most aspirants found challenging, has been removed.
Unit 14: Statistics and Probability
  • Bernoulli trials and binomial distribution have been removed from the syllabus. 
Unit 15: Trigonometry
  • Equations have been removed from the syllabus.
  • Heights and Distance has also been omitted.
Unit 16: Mathematical Reasoning
  • The entire chapter has been removed from the syllabus. 

JEE Physics Syllabus 2024

Unlike seen for the JEE Maths syllabus 2024 units either getting reduced or canceled, the JEE Physics syllabus 2024 has been different. Meaning in the new Physics JEE main syllabus, there have been additions as well as reductions in the syllabus. Let us discuss them below:

Unit 1: Physics and Measurement
  • Accuracy and precision of measuring instruments have been removed.
  • Significant figures have been newly added.
Unit 2: Kinematics
  • Zero Vector has been removed from the topic.
Unit 3: Laws of Motion
  • Circular road and vehicle on a banked road have been newly added to the previous syllabus.
Unit 4: Work, Energy and Power
  • Instead of ‘neoconservative forces’ now it has been changed to ‘non-conservative forces’.
  • Motion in a vertical circle has been added.
Unit 5: Rotation Motion
  • Earlier, it was ‘Rigid body rotation equations of rotational motion’. However, this has gotten more trimmed. Now it is, ‘Equilibrium of rigid bodies, rigid body rotation equations of rotational motion, comparison of linear and rotational motion’.
Unit 6: Gravitation
  • Geo Stationary Satellites have been removed from the syllabus.
  • Motion of a satellite, Orbital velocity, Time period and energy of satellite has been added to the syllabus.
Unit 7: Properties of Solids and Liquids 
  • Newton’s law of cooling is removed from the syllabus.
  • The effect of gravity on fluid pressure has been added.
  • Excess of pressure across a curved surface is also added.
Unit 8: Thermodynamics
  • The Carnot engine and its efficiency has been removed.
  • Isothermal and adiabatic processes have been added.
Unit 9: Kinetic Theory of Gases
  • The topic remains the same.
Unit 10: Oscillations and Waves
  • Forced and damped oscillations, resonance have been removed from the syllabus.
  • Along with that, the Doppler Effect in Sound has been removed.
Unit 11: Electrostatics
  • There have been no changes to this topic.
Unit 12: Current Electricity
  • Resistances of different materials have been removed from the syllabus.
  • Colour code for resistors has also been removed.
  • Potentiometer – Principle and its applications has been removed.
  • Mobility and their relation with electric current have been added.
  • Metre Bridge is a topic that has been removed from the NCERT but continues to stay in the syllabus for JEE Main syllabus 2024.
Unit 13: Magnetic Effects of Current and Magnetism
  • Cyclotron has been removed.
  • Earth’s magnetic field has been removed from the syllabus.
  • Other two topics that have been removed from the unit are ‘Electromagnets and Permanent Magnets’ and ‘Hysteresis’.
  • Magnetic field due to a magnetic dipole (Bar magnet) along its axis and perpendicular to its axis has been added.
  • Torque on a magnetic dipole in a uniform magnetic field has also been added.
  • Another topic that has been omitted from the NCERT but added to the JEE 2024 syllabus is,’ The effect of temperature on magnetic properties’.
Unit 14: Electromagnetic Induction and Alternating Currents
  • Quality factor has been removed from the JEE mains syllabus 2024 and also NCERT.
Unit 15: Electromagnetic Waves
  • Displacement Current has been added to the main exam of JEE 2024 syllabus.
Unit 16: Optics
  • The resolving power of microscopes and astronomical telescopes has been removed from JEE main. 
  • Instead, ‘Thin lens formula, and lens maker formula, and lens maker formula’ has been added.
Unit 17: Dual Nature of Matter and Radiation
  • Davisson – Germer experiment has been removed. 
Unit 18: Atoms and Nuclei
  • Isotopes, Isobars: Isotones have been removed.
  • The entire topic of Radioactivity has been removed from the syllabus.
Unit 19: Electronic Devices
  • ’Junction transistor, transistor action, characteristics of a transistor: transistor as an amplifier (common emitter configuration) and oscillator’ has been omitted. 
Unit 20: Communication System
  • The entire unit has been removed from JEE mains syllabus 2024.
Unit 21: Experimental Skills
  • Point 8 and point 13 has been removed. 

JEE Chemistry Syllabus 2024

The NTA has made major reductions in the Chemistry subject of the JEE Mains syllabus for 2024. It is imperative for all aspirants who are appearing or preparing for JEE main exam in 2024. The changes in the new syllabus for JEE main exam are mentioned below.

Unit 1: Some Basic Concepts in Chemistry
  • Physical quantities and their measurements in Chemistry, precision, and accuracy have been removed.
  • Significant Figures, S.I. units, and dimensional analysis have also been removed from the syllabus.
Unit 2: States of Matter
  • The entire chapter has been canceled.
Unit 3: Atomic Structure
  • Thomson and Rutherford atomic models and their limitations has been struck out from the  JEE 2024 syllabus.
Unit 4: Chemical Bonding and Molecular
  • No changes have been made.
Unit 5: Chemical Thermodynamics
  • Entropy has been added.
Unit 6: Solutions
  • The topics remain the same.
Unit 7: Equilibrium
  • There have been no changes here.
Unit 8: Redox Reactions and Electrochemistry
  • Even in this unit, no changes have been made.
Unit 9: Chemical Kinetics
  • The unit remains the same.
Unit 10: Surface Chemistry
  • This unit has been omitted.
Unit 11: Classification of Elements and Periodicity in Properties
  • No changes have been made.
Unit 12: General Principles and Processes of Isolation of Metals
  • The chapter has been removed.
Unit 13: Hydrogen
  • This chapter has been removed.
Unit 14: S-Block Elements
  • Alkali and Alkaline Earth metals are removed from the JEE 2024 syllabus.

Unit 15: P-Block Elements

  • From Group 13 to Group 18, only general knowledge is included in the syllabus. However, the details that are removed include the preparation, properties, structure, tendency, etc.

Unit 16: D and F Block Elements

  • The syllabus remains the same.
Unit 17: Co-ordination Compounds
  • There have been no changes in this unit.
Unit 18: Environmental Chemistry
  • This unit has been removed.
Unit 19: Purification and Characterisation of Organic Compounds
  • The unit syllabus remains the same.
Unit20: Some Basic Principles of Organic Chemistry
  • Follows the old syllabus.
Unit 21: Hydrocarbons
  • No changes were made.
Unit 22: Organic Compounds Containing Halogens
  • The topics remain the same.
Unit 23: Organic Compounds Containing Oxygen
  • There have been no changes in the unit.
Unit 24. Organic Compounds Containing Nitrogen
  • The unit syllabus remains the same.
Unit 25: Polymers
  • The entire unit has been removed.
Unit 26: Biomolecules
  • Hormones (General information) have been added.
Unit 27: Chemistry In Everyday Life
  • This unit has been removed.
Unit 28: Principles Related to Practical Chemistry
  • The unit syllabus remains the same.

Conclusion

Following the CBSE’s reduction of a few chapters from the 11th and 12th syllabi in 2020, the NTA has modified the syllabus for the JEE Main 2024 examination and beyond. This change has been implemented just two months before the commencement of JEE Mains 2024. Section 1 of the exam is scheduled from January 24 to February 1, while Section 2 will take place from April 1 to April 5. It is essential for students to be familiar with the revised syllabus before appearing for the exam.
